Carbon nanotubes (CNTs) possess exceptional mechanical durability and electrical conductivity, making them ideal for a wide array of cutting-edge applications. These tiny cylindrical structures exhibit remarkable tensile strength, exceeding that of steel by orders of magnitude. Moreover, CNTs demonstrate excellent thermal dissipation, enabling efficient heat management in high-performance devices. The unique combination of these properties has propelled CNTs to the forefront of materials science research, with potential applications spanning diverse fields such as aerospace, electronics, and medicine.
For instance, CNTs can be incorporated into composite materials to enhance their mechanical attributes. In aerospace engineering, CNT-reinforced polymers offer exceptional stiffness and weight reduction, leading to more fuel-efficient aircraft and spacecraft. In the realm of electronics, CNTs serve as highly efficient transistors, paving the way for faster and smaller electronic devices. Furthermore, CNTs hold promise in biomedical applications, with potential uses in drug delivery, biosensors, and tissue engineering. As research progresses, we can expect to see even more innovative and transformative applications of these remarkable materials.

Carbon Nanotube Bundles: Unlocking the Potential of Strength and Conductivity
Carbon nanotube bundles present a compelling combination of exceptional durability and remarkable conductivity. These tightly packed arrays of individual nanotubes exploit their inherent properties to exceed conventional materials in both mechanical and electrical performance. The interlocking nature of the bundles distributes stress efficiently, resulting in unparalleled tensile strength. Simultaneously, the parallel arrangement of nanotubes facilitates the unhindered movement of electrons, leading to impressive conductivity. This synergistic blend of properties makes carbon nanotube bundles highly versatile for a wide range of applications in fields such as electronics, aerospace, and healthcare.
